Работа с функцией квадратного корня (root) в программе MathCad — основные принципы и примеры использования


Matlab – это популярная инженерно-научная система математических расчетов, которая имеет мощные инструменты для работы с данными. Одним из таких инструментов является функция «Root», которая возвращает числовое значение корня уравнения. В этой статье мы рассмотрим принцип работы и особенности функции «Root» в Matcad.

Функция «Root» принимает два аргумента: само уравнение и начальное приближение для корня. Она основана на методе Ньютона, который является одним из самых эффективных численных методов для нахождения корней уравнений. Основная идея метода Ньютона заключается в последовательном приближении к искомому корню путем линейной аппроксимации касательной к графику уравнения.

Одной из особенностей функции «Root» в Matcad является возможность нахождения не только одного, но и всех корней уравнения. Для этого нужно использовать вспомогательную функцию «Roots», которая принимает только один аргумент — уравнение. Функция «Roots» возвращает все корни уравнения в виде списка значений.

Root в Маткаде: способ решения уравнений

В программе Mathcad возможно решение уравнений с использованием функции Root. Эта функция предназначена для поиска численного значения корня уравнения на заданном интервале. С помощью Root можно найти не только корни алгебраических уравнений, но и корни трансцендентных уравнений.

Принцип работы функции Root состоит в нахождении числа x, при котором уравнение f(x) = 0. Функция может иметь несколько корней, и Root будет искать их все на заданном интервале. Для поиска корней уравнения необходимо задать функцию f(x), начальное приближение x0 и интервал, в котором будет осуществляться поиск корней.

Пример использования функции Root:

f(x) := x^2 - 9;solutions := Root(f(x) = 0, x, [0, 10]);

В данном примере задано уравнение f(x) = 0, где f(x) = x^2 — 9. Функция Root ищет корень уравнения на интервале от 0 до 10 и записывает результат в переменную solutions. Если корень найден, то функция Root возвращает его численное значение. Если же корень не был найден, то в переменную solutions будет записано значение «функция не определена».

Важно отметить, что функция Root может не всегда находить все корни уравнения, особенно если интервал поиска слишком большой или присутствуют слишком сложные математические выражения. В таких случаях необходимо использовать другие методы решения уравнений, доступные в Mathcad, например, функцию solve.

Как работает Root в Маткаде и для чего он нужен

Root работает путем определения значения, которое возводится в указанную степень и приравнивает его к заданному значению. Затем программа находит корень из этого значения и возвращает результат.

Кроме того, Root обладает несколькими полезными возможностями:

  • Использование аргумента «n» позволяет находить корень n-й степени. При этом значение «n» может быть как целым числом, так и дробным.
  • Root может использоваться как функция для решения уравнений, когда необходимо найти неизвестное значение, находящееся под корнем.
  • Возможность нахождения нескольких корней позволяет решать сложные системы уравнений с несколькими неизвестными.

Root в Mathcad предлагает широкие возможности для решения различных математических задач. Он позволяет находить корни высших степеней, решать уравнения и системы уравнений с помощью программирования. Благодаря своей функциональности и удобству использования Mathcad с Root становится мощным инструментом для решения разнообразных математических задач.

Добавить комментарий

Вам также может понравиться